Community Health Center of Spencer
Community Health Center of Spencer offers medical, dental, and behavioral health services for patients of all ages and in multiple languages. We serve all people, whether payment for services would be made under Medicare, Medicaid, or CHIP; or the individual’s race, color, sex, national origin, disability, religion or age. No one will be denied access to services due to inability to pay, our discounted/sliding fee schedule is available based on family size and income.

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T)–Palo Alto County Health System
Palo Alto County Health System offers a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) program to help individuals manage the symptoms of drug and alcohol disorders. MAT is an evidence-based practice that combines FDA-approved medication with substance abuse counseling and social support and is introducing people to recovery and improving their lives.
